Smartphones as Mobile Wallets: Gone are the days when physical wallets were the primary means of carrying money. Today, smartphones have become digital wallets, enabling users to make secure payments, transfer funds, and manage their finances on the go. With the help of Near Field Communication (NFC) technology and mobile payment apps like Apple Pay and Google Pay, individuals can now make contactless payments simply by tapping their phones. These advancements have made transactions quicker, more convenient, and safer, reducing the reliance on cash and traditional banking methods. 2. Wearable Devices for Personal Finance: Wearable devices, such as smartwatches and fitness trackers, have extended their functionality beyond health and fitness monitoring. They now serve as personal finance assistants, providing real-time updates on financial activities. From tracking expenses and monitoring budgets to alerting users about upcoming bills and financial goals, these devices provide users with a holistic view of their financial well-being. Additionally, some wearables offer secure biometric authentication, ensuring enhanced security in financial transactions. 3. Smart Home Devices for Intelligent Banking: The rise of smart home devices like voice assistants and connected appliances has opened up new possibilities for seamless integration with financial services. Users can now inquire about account balances, pay bills, and make money transfers through voice commands to virtual assistants like Amazon's Alexa or Google Assistant. These devices also enable users to receive timely notifications and alerts about their financial transactions, ensuring greater control and transparency over their finances from the comfort of their own homes. 4. Blockchain and Cryptocurrency: Blockchain technology, the backbone of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um, has disrupted traditional financial systems. It offers a transparent, secure, and decentralized platform for peer-to-peer transactions, eliminating the need for intermediaries such as banks. Electronic products, ranging from specialized hardware wallets to mobile applications, provide users with convenient access to their digital assets and enable them to securely manage their cryptocurrency portfolios. This marriage of electronic products and blockchain technology has brought financial autonomy and privacy to individuals worldwide. 5. Artificial Intelligence for Personalized Financial Advice: Artificial Intelligence (AI) has found its way into the financial industry, offering personalized financial advice and investment recommendations. Electronic products equipped with AI algorithms can analyze individuals' spending habits, assess risk profiles, and suggest tailored investment strategies. They can monitor market trends, detect anomalies, and notify users of potential risks or opportunities. The marriage of fintech and AI ensures that users can make informed financial decisions while also benefiting from greater convenience and efficiency.
